Post by stevejamsecono » Wed Mar 09, 2022 9:17 am

Just got mine back from my repair guy. After a refret, quick rewire, and polishing all the goop off, it looks pretty dang nice. A stealth thing of beauty, if you ask me! :)

Image2022-03-09 by Steve Bailey, on Flickr

Also I don't normally engage in such collector mentality things, but I impulse bought a Yamaha print catalogue from the same era pretty recently as well. Seeing as the thin-bodied SG1000's only lasted a few years (83-85ish?), it's cool to have written proof of them.
